This page documents how Hushline release artifacts are traced from source to deployment. Each deduplicator build is produced on an isolated runner, with dependencies pinned by lockfile hash and no network access during compilation. The signing step records the commit, runner image digest, and pipeline run in an attestation stored alongside the artifact. Reviewers should confirm that the attestation chain is unbroken before approving promotion. The artifact currently under review is identified by the token below.

trace token, kajef-bahip: htk14_d9270d12f0002c

## Billing worker: blue-green cutover

1. Scale green Ledgerette workers to match blue.
2. Drain blue queue; confirm zero in-flight invoices.
3. Flip the Tollgate router flag.
4. Watch error rate for 10 minutes; revert flag on any spike.
5. Decommission blue after one clean billing cycle.

Record the deploy by pasting the trace token just below this line.

session token of baguf-bageg = htk3_538

Runbook: Wrenpipe websocket compression. Enabling permessage-deflate cuts bandwidth ~60% but raises CPU and memory per connection; disable it first when nodes show memory pressure. Mobile clients on the Tarnow gateway negotiate it by default. Toggling requires a rolling restart, not a drain. Current per-region settings and the toggle procedure are documented on the internal page below.

operations page: https://gitlab.brasksoft.test/job/settings/board/run/40efbcc000391685